问题标签 [vorpal]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
javascript - 以编程方式关闭 Vorpal 实例
这涉及 node.js 的 vorpal CLI,如下所示:
用户可以使用Ctrl-关闭 vorpal C,但是如何以编程方式关闭 vorpal?
例如,如果打开了 vorpal 终端会话,但 25 秒后没有收到进一步的标准输入,我想以编程方式关闭 vorpal,我的代码如下所示:
node.js - Node.js Vorpal CLI - 将子命令作为一个命令包含在内
假设我们有这个:
如何为 sumanOptions 传递命令字符串(“子命令”)?像这样的东西:
vorpal> find "a b c" myfolder
这样在动作回调的 args 中,看起来像:
这可能吗?还是这个问题是我在问题跟踪器中看到的“子命令”问题?我希望能够做到这一点,到目前为止,还无法弄清楚如何做到这一点。
javascript - Vorpal Vantage:我无法以编程方式退出交互式控制台
这有什么问题?
错误:
UI Prompt 已在提示中间时调用。在 Object.prompt (/Users/giggioz/Spaghetti/keeper/keeper-giochipiu-delegates/node_modules/vorpal/lib/ui.js:131:13) 在 Vorpal.vorpal.prompt (/Users/giggioz/Spaghetti/keeper/ keeper-giochipiu-delegates/node_modules/vorpal/lib/vorpal.js:450:8) 在 Vorpal.vorpal.exit (/Users/giggioz/Spaghetti/keeper/keeper-giochipiu-delegates/node_modules/vorpal/lib/vorpal. js:1160:12) 在会议上。(/Users/giggioz/Spaghetti/keeper/keeper-giochipiu-delegates/node_modules/vorpal/lib/vorpal-commons.js:49:19) 在 Vorpal.vorpal._exec (/Users/giggioz/Spaghetti/keeper/keeper- giochipiu-delegates/node_modules/vorpal/lib/vorpal.js:846:18) 在 Vorpal.vorpal._execQueueItem (/Users/giggioz/Spaghetti/keeper/keeper-giochipiu-delegates/node_modules/vorpal/lib/vorpal.js: 594:10) 在 Vorpal.vorpal。